S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S FOR SANDERS
Avoid damage that can be caused by screws, nails and
other elements in your workpiece; remove them before
you start working
Always keep the cord away from moving parts of the tool;
direct the cord to the rear, away from the tool
When you put away the tool, switch o the motor and ensure
that all moving parts have come to a complete standstill
Use completely unrolled and safe extension cords with a
capacity of 16 Amps (U.K. 13 Amps)
In case of electrical or mechanical malfunction,
immediately switch o the tool and disconnect the plug
SKIL can assure awless functioning of the tool only
when the correct accessories are used which can be
obtained from your SKIL dealer
This tool should not be used by people under the age of
16 years
The noise level when working can exceed 85 dB(A);
wear ear protection
If the cord is damaged or cut through while working, do
not touch the cord, but immediately disconnect the plug
Never use the tool when cord is damaged; have it
replaced by a qualied person
Always check that the supply voltage is the same as the
voltage indicated on the nameplate of the tool (tools with
a rating of 230V or 240V can also be connected to a
220V supply)
This tool is not suitable for wet sanding
Secure the workpiece (a workpiece clamped with
clamping devices or in a vice is held more securely than
by hand)
Do not work materials containing asbestos (asbestos
is considered carcinogenic)
When sanding metal, sparks are generated; do not use
dustbag and keep other persons and combustible
material from work area
Do not touch the moving sanding sheet
Do not continue to use worn, torn or heavily clogged
sanding sheets
Wear protective gloves, safety glasses, close-tting
clothes and hair protection (for long hair)
Dust from material such as paint containing lead, some
wood species, minerals and metal may be harmful
(contact with or inhalation of the dust may cause allergic
reactions and/or respiratory diseases to the operator or
bystanders); wear a dust mask and work with a dust
extraction device when connectable
Certain kinds of dust are classied as carcinogenic (such
as oak and beech dust) especially in conjunction with
additives for wood conditioning; wear a dust mask and
work with a dust extraction device when connectable
Follow the dust-related national requirements for the
materials you want to work with
Always disconnect plug from power source before
making any adjustment or changing any accessory

USE
Mounting of sanding sheet 4
! disconnect the plug
- mount VELCRO sanding sheet as illustrated
- use lever A for mounting regular sanding sheets
! the dust suction requires the use of perforated
sanding sheets
- use paper punch B for adapting non-perforated
sanding sheets to dust suction
! perforation in sanding sheet should correspond
with perforation in sanding foot
! replace worn sanding sheets in time
! always use the tool with the total sanding surface
covered with sanding paper
Dust suction 5
- empty dustbox C regularly for optimal dust pick-up
performance
- remove dustbox C by pushing knob D to the left and hold
it in that position while pulling dustbox C backwards
- mount dustbox C by sliding it back until it clicks into place
! lock dustbox C before mounting
- when necessary, also clean the lter as illustrated
! do not use dustbox when sanding metal
Mounting/removing of vacuum cleaner adapter E 6
! do not use vacuum cleaner when sanding metal
On/o switch
- switch on/o the tool by pushing switch F 2
forward/backwards
! before the sanding surface reaches the
workpiece, you should switch on the tool
! before switching off the tool, you should lift it
from the workpiece
Speed control
For optimal sanding results on dierent materials
- with wheel G 2 you can set the desired sanding speed
- adjust speed to grit size used
- before starting a job, nd the optimal speed and grit by
testing out on spare material
Holding and guiding the tool 7
! while working, always hold the tool at the
grey-coloured grip area(s)
- guide the tool parallel to the working surface
! do not apply too much pressure on the tool; let
the sanding surface do the work for you
- do not tilt the tool in order to avoid unwanted
sanding marks
- keep ventilation slots H 2 uncovered
